    You almost fell out of your new chair..... Toontracks has been my goto drum kit for years. (EZ Drummer my 1st too) What I have players do is one of two ways of recording their drummer live. One is separate tracks for the kit. Then I can convert each track to a midi file in Cubase and replace desired parts of the kit with Superior drummer 3. The other way is that some players use electronic kits and they record the drum tracks as well as the corresponding MIDI tracks to each part of the kit. I import to Cubase and edit. Love the samples in Superior Drummer 3. Being a drummer before I got into scoring, It takes the worry out of having a piece of kit that works perfectly right out of the box. And for quicky sessions, I have a selection of pre-made loops for easy drop-in and play. I have no less than 10 custom kits, on & on. Great vid Guy.

    Yep. Been down exactly the same road... EZ drummer->SD2-> SD3. It's great, as demonstrated here, and it does have a load of depth to it.
    2 things...
    One) You don't have to download/install all 240GBytes of samples... if you don't need the extra 11.1 mics, the basic kit is only(!) 40GB, so makes it easier. You can always download the rest at a later date if you need them.
    Two) it IS 40GB in size!
    If you haven't seen it, you might want to check out the MODOdrum package released recently (IK MultiMedia , i think). It is more of a Modelling kit, rather than a massive sampled library. And what it lacks in ultimate (almost overkill!) sound, it more that makes up for in editablilty and the fact that it's much smaller that standard sampled kits. Check Dancetech's YT page for a great demo of this instrument.

    This is propably one of the most comprehensive and well wrote Drum plugins. One thing I would really like from toontracks tho is ... Drum editor and drum layout files have been around since the Atari days of Cubase and has always been a good editor for making drum tracks... so why don't they provide some drum layouts for cubase of the base sets included in the program. Then you can easy change the i-notes in cubase if you like me have pretty much all drum placements on the keybed in the head from the days of GM/GS so you can use your favorite layout no matter wich strange note placements they have for all those different articulations. EZ drummer been a favorite of mine for years but always needed to spent quite some time on doing drumsetups from scratch for it
